Very Berry Chocolate Chunk Muffins
Ingredients:
- 1/2 cup sugar
- 1/4 cup brown sugar
- 1 mashed banana
- 1/2 cup oat milk or other non-dairy milk
- 1/4 cup melted coconut oil
- 1/4 cup maple syrup
- 1/2 cup applesauce
- 2 cups gluten-free all-purpose flour
- 2 teaspoons baking powder
- 1 teaspoon salt
- 3/4 cup mixed berries*
- 3/4 cup vegan dark chocolate chunks*
Instructions:
- Preheat oven to 425 degrees F. and line 2 muffin tins with 18 muffin cups.
- In a large bowl, whisk together the brown sugar, sugar, banana, non-dairy milk, oil, maple syrup and applesauce.
- Combine the dry ingredients in a separate bowl.
- Add the berries to the dry ingredients and toss to combine.
- Add the berry / flour mixture to the wet ingredients and fold together just until combined. The mixture will still be a little chunky. Fold in the chocolate chunks.
- Fill the muffin cups about 3/4 of the way full.
- Bake at 425 degrees F. for 5 minutes. Without opening the oven, reduce the heat to 350 degrees F. and bake for another 15-20 minutes or until a toothpick comes out clean.*
